Woman in 70s dies after being hit by car at pedestrian crossing on A28 Canterbury Road, Westgate-on-Sea

A woman has died and another is seriously injured after they were hit by a car at a pedestrian crossing.

The collision happened on the A28 Canterbury Road, at its junction with St Mildreds Road, in Westgate-on-Sea at 5.06pm last night.

A blue Ford Fiesta was travelling towards Margate when it was involved in a collision with the two women who were walking across the carriageway, at a traffic light-controlled pedestrian crossing. The vehicle stopped at the scene.

One woman, in her 70s, died at the scene.

The second was treated for injuries and then taken to hospital, where she remains in a serious but stable condition.

No arrests have been made in connection with the incident.

Officers are now appealing to anyone who saw the crash.

A police spokesman said: “Serious collision investigators are appealing to any witnesses who have not yet spoken to police to come forward.

“Anyone who saw what happened, or who may have relevant dashcam or CCTV footage, should call the appeal line on 01622 798538 quoting reference EX/YP/003/25.

“You can also email sciu.td@kent.police.uk.”

There was a huge emergency response to the incident, which saw the busy route shut for several hours.
